Summary

Performs medical office duties including verifying insurance, answering phones, scheduling patient appointments, registering patients, and entering all billing information into the system. Collects co-pays and performs pre-certifications and filing.

Position Responsibilities

  • Answers and screens phone calls by the third ring. Directs all calls to appropriate staff member, ensuring all information is accurate.
  • Schedules patient appointments and registers patients, including updating and verifying all system demographics and insurance information.
  • Performs billing functions such as entering charges and payments, collecting co-pays, reconciling batches and preparing deposits.
  • Prepares referrals and obtains pre-certifications as required.
  • May train and direct office assistants at sites, including preparation of work and training schedules. Acts as office resource and mentoring role model.

Position Qualifications

  • Excellent communication and customer service skills.
  • Strong multi-tasking abilities and computer literacy.
  • 0-2 years Medical Office experience.

Required Education

HS diploma or equivalent.

Compensation and Benefits

Hourly Rate: $17.97 - $25.20. The actual salary/rate will vary based on applicant's experience as well as internal equity and alignment with market data.

Virtua offers a comprehensive benefits package for full-time and part-time colleagues, including medical/prescription, dental and vision insurance; health and dependent care flexible spending accounts; 403(b) (401(k) subject to collective bargaining agreement); paid time off, paid sick leave as provided under state and local paid sick leave laws, short-term disability and optional long-term disability, life insurance and supplemental life and AD&D insurance for colleagues and dependents; tuition assistance; and an employee assistance program that includes free counseling sessions. Eligibility for benefits is governed by the applicable plan documents and policies.
